The Importance Of Hi-Visibility Clothing For Safety

Every year, thousands of accidents occur in the workplace, on construction sites, and on the roads due to low visibility conditions. In an effort to reduce these accidents and keep workers safe, hi-visibility clothing has become an essential part of many industries. hi-visibility clothing, also known as high-vis or hi-viz clothing, is designed to make wearers stand out in low light conditions, such as at night or in foggy weather. This type of clothing is often made with fluorescent materials in bright colors like yellow, orange, or red, and is equipped with reflective tape to enhance visibility in poor lighting situations.

The main purpose of hi-visibility clothing is to ensure that workers are easily seen by others, especially in environments where there is a risk of being struck by moving vehicles or machinery. For example, construction workers, road workers, and traffic controllers all wear hi-visibility clothing to alert drivers to their presence and reduce the chances of accidents occurring. In fact, research has shown that wearing hi-visibility clothing can reduce the risk of accidents by up to 85%, making it an essential safety precaution in many industries.

While hi-visibility clothing is most commonly associated with safety in the workplace, it is also used in a variety of other settings to enhance visibility and reduce the risk of accidents. For example, cyclists and joggers often wear hi-visibility clothing to make themselves more visible to drivers on the road, while hunters and hikers wear hi-visibility gear to stand out in wooded areas and prevent accidents. In these cases, hi-visibility clothing serves as a simple and effective way to stay safe and alert others to your presence in potentially hazardous environments.

When it comes to choosing hi-visibility clothing, there are a few key factors to keep in mind. First and foremost, it is important to select clothing that meets industry safety standards and regulations, such as the ANSI/ISEA 107 standard for hi-visibility apparel. This ensures that the clothing is made with high-quality materials and designed to provide maximum visibility in a range of conditions. Additionally, it is important to consider the specific needs of your environment and choose clothing that is appropriate for the level of risk you face on a daily basis.
